#723589 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#723589 is composed of 44.7% red, 20.8% green and 53.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 16.8% cyan, 61.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 46.3% black. It has a hue angle of 283.6 degrees, a saturation of 44.2% and a lightness of 37.3%. #723589 color hex could be obtained by blending #e46aff with #000013.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#723589

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08040a is the darkest color, while #fdfbf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#723589

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#615a64 is the less saturated color, while #8902bc is the most saturated one.
